Specifications
Absolute Pull Range (APR): --
Current - Supply (Disable) (Max): 30mA
Height - Seated (Max): 0.209" (5.30mm)
Size / Dimension: 0.539" L x 0.260" W (13.70mm x 6.60mm)
Package / Case: 8-DIP, 4 Leads (Half Size)
Mounting Type: Through Hole
Ratings: --
Current - Supply (Max): 45mA
Operating Temperature: -20°C ~ 70°C
Series: SG-531P
Frequency Stability: ±100ppm
Voltage - Supply: 5V
Output: CMOS, TTL
Function: Enable/Disable
Frequency: 3.276MHz
Type: XO (Standard)
Base Resonator: Crystal
Part Status: Active

Oscillators

Oscillators are widely used in electromechanical systems for a variety of functions, including signal generation, signal synchronization, clock generation, and timing applications. Oscillators have many different types, such as quartz crystal oscillators, digital clock oscillators, voltage-controlled oscillators, and so on. SG-531P 3.2760MC: ROHS is an example of an oscillator.

Application Field of SG-531P 3.2760MC: ROHS

The SG-531P 3.2760MC: ROHS is a quartz crystal oscillator with ROHS certification. It is especially suitable for use in industrial, scientific, and medical instruments and applications due to its high stability and accuracy. It can also be used in communication devices, remote control, military equipment, automotive electronics, and PCs/PDAs for frequency control.

Working Principle of SG-531P 3.2760MC: ROHS

The working principle of SG-531P 3.2760MC: ROHS is based on the resonance principle of quartz. The SG-531P 3.2760MC: ROHS is mainly composed of an oscillator circuit and a crystal oscillator. The oscillator circuit is responsible for amplifying the small signal of the crystal oscillator to form an oscillating signal. The crystal oscillator is responsible for providing a stable and accurate frequency reference. It works by coupling the mechanical vibration of a quartz crystal to an electrical circuit. The crystal oscillator has two electrodes, one for providing a driving voltage, and the other for providing the output signal. The generated output frequency is determined by the material and the shape of the quartz crystal.
